Abstract

The article presents the results of the monitoring of adverse events following the immunization (AEFI) with vaccines in the National calendar of preventive vaccinations in the medical organizations of the Republic of Tatarstan. The characteristic of registered AEFIs, their clinical characteristics is applied. Issues of registration of AEFI and prospects of improving the AEFI registration are discudded. For the analyzed period 711 cases of adverse reactions after vaccines were registered. The analysis revealed that adverse reactions after vaccines have been detected as short-term general disorders and defects at the injection site.

В статье представлены результаты мониторинга побочных проявлений после иммунизации (ПППИ) вакцинами в рамках Национального календаря профилактических прививок в медицинских организациях Республики Татарстан. Даны характеристики зарегистрированных ПППИ, их клинических проявлений. Рассмотрены вопросы регистрации ПППИ и перспективы улучшения регистрации ПППИ. За анализируемый период зарегистрировано 711 случаев нежелательных реакций после применения вакцин. Проведенный анализ выявил, что нежелательные реакции после применения вакцин регистрировались в виде кратковременных общих расстройств и нарушений в месте введения препарата.
